WebSep 2, 2024 · RIDDOR stands for the Reporting of Injuries Diseases and Dangerous Occurrences Regulations and applies to workplaces of all sizes across the UK. RIDDOR applies to every workplace in the UK, so it's a legal requirement to understand the rules, what you need to report, and when.

There is a clear definition of an accident in terms of RIDDOR, “a separate, identifiable, unintended incident that causes physical injury” including acts of non-consensual violence.
